Les Granges de la Vallée Étroite thematic trail
Follow Croc la Pomme de Pin along a themed trail to discover the history of the Vallée Etroite! Following the torrent, the trail is lined with explanatory panels, from the 7 fountains dam to the hamlet of Les Granges.
Description
The route starts from the Sept Fontaines dam, the first part of the trail climbs through a pine forest and continues flat to the Plaine des Militaires, formerly known as "Plan do Vurzné".
Along the plateau, the path follows the bed of the Vallée Étroite stream, at the foot of the Paroi des Militaires, to reach the sheepfold at the place known as "Ranfaurë", named after the wind's breath. Beyond the sheepfold, the path continues along the stream, crossing "i Pa dla Giarina" to reach Lënga Bruina, where the cows graze in summer.
The path then rises a few metres before reaching the parking area next to the road leading to the hamlet of Les Granges.
